Save $$$$$. Buy the bundle! This color by number math bundle contains six products with an Earth Day theme. WebNumber patterns are a sequence of numbers with a common relationship. For example, in the sequence 3,6,9,12, each number is increasing by three. Generally speaking, once a child is confident enough with numbers to count unassisted, they are ready to start exploring sequences.
